Вопрос по С++

Live

Happy Live :)
Ответ: c++. как реализовать в классе ссылку на метод этого класса?

Хочу изучить С++ Builder.
у кого есть справочник ну или учебное пособие или книга?
Буду благодарен!
 

Live

Happy Live :)
подскажите пожалуста как реализовать:
необходимо динамически создать объект класса. С тем расчетом что пользователь вводит имя и програма должна создать объект класса с таким именем.

case '4': cout<<" Введите имя нового объекта \n";
cin>>new_class_name;
// и тут как-нибудь из того что ввел пользователь слепить объект

я просто в трауре.. :vis: :gost:
 
Останнє редагування:

serg_pet

New Member
Ответ: Вопрос по С++

GR!NWY сказав(ла):
подскажите пожалуста как реализовать:
необходимо динамически создать объект класса. С тем расчетом что пользователь вводит имя и програма должна создать объект класса с таким именем.

case '4': cout<<" Введите имя нового объекта \n";
cin>>new_class_name;
// и тут как-нибудь из того что ввел пользователь слепить объект

я просто в трауре.. :vis: :gost:
на сколько я знаю это невозможно. В языках в которых методология говорит о том, чтобы все переменные которые юзаются должны быть описаны ЗАРАНЕЕ такого сделать нельзя.
 

Live

Happy Live :)
Ответ: Вопрос по С++

в задаче сказано: предусмотреть возможность создания объектов.
может понял не точно но в моем понимании это создание любого объекта какой пользователь пожелает.. жаль ...придется Скаковской так и сказать. мол довольствуйтесь только теми объектами которые уже созданы!!!
 

serg_pet

New Member
Ответ: Вопрос по С++

GR!NWY сказав(ла):
в задаче сказано: предусмотреть возможность создания объектов.
может понял не точно но в моем понимании это создание любого объекта какой пользователь пожелает.. жаль ...придется Скаковской так и сказать. мол довольствуйтесь только теми объектами которые уже созданы!!!
оооо. Скаковская... да, не весело. :)
по крайней мере как ты описал, что мол с клавы ввести и создастся объект так точно нельзя.
если не сложно набери задание или фотку выложи, потому что скорее всего ты не так понял, а препод в свою очередь мог не совсем однозначно сформулировать.
 

Live

Happy Live :)
Ответ: Вопрос по С++

Задание
Построить описание класса содержащего информацию о почтовом адресе организации. Предусмотреть возможность раздельного изменения составных частей адреса создания и уничтожения объектов этого класса. Первоначально значение адреса проинициализировать конструктором по значению, вывести обычной ф-цией класса. Измененные адреса вывести в дружественной.
При изменении частей адреса предусмотреть запрос: что именно изменить. Написать програму демонстрирующую работу с этим классом. Програма должна содержать меню позволяющее осуществлять проверку всех методов класса.
так все понятно кроме создания объектов бог его знает как их на ЛЕТУ создавать :kngt:
You must be registered for see images
 

Ширик

Подземный Кот
Ответ: Вопрос по С++

Надо было брать задание для ломов.
 

serg_pet

New Member
Ответ: Вопрос по С++

GR!NWY сказав(ла):
Задание
Построить описание класса содержащего информацию о почтовом адресе организации. Предусмотреть возможность раздельного изменения составных частей адреса создания и уничтожения объектов этого класса. Первоначально значение адреса проинициализировать конструктором по значению, вывести обычной ф-цией класса. Измененные адреса вывести в дружественной.
При изменении частей адреса предусмотреть запрос: что именно изменить. Написать програму демонстрирующую работу с этим классом. Програма должна содержать меню позволяющее осуществлять проверку всех методов класса.
так все понятно кроме создания объектов бог его знает как их на ЛЕТУ создавать :kngt:
да тут не надо создавать экземпляр класса на лету, тут тебе в курсаче просто надо написать в конструкторе класса, типа объект создан.
или вообще Скаковскую обхитрить
cout<<"Введите имя класса";
cin>>cl_name;

а конструктор описать типа так
Class_name (string s){
...
cout<<"Объект с именем"<<s<<"Создан"
}
словил идею?
это будет круто :)
 

Live

Happy Live :)
Ответ: Вопрос по С++

хх сделаю намного проще
cin>>new_class_name;
сout<<"Объект создан";
Serg Pet сенкс за разъяснение
 
Зверху